findStructuralDamping

Найдите демпфирующую модель, назначенную модели структурной динамики

Описание

пример

dma = findStructuralDamping(structuralmodel.DampingModels) возвращает модель демпфирования и ее параметры, присвоенные модели структурной динамики. Тулбокс поддерживает пропорциональную (Релея) модель демпфирования и модальную модель демпфирования. Параметрами пропорциональной модели демпфирования являются пропорциональные параметры демпфирования массы и жесткости. Параметром модели модального демпфирования является модальный коэффициент затухания.

Используйте эту функцию, чтобы найти какие модель и параметры демпфирования в настоящее время активны, если вы сделали несколько назначений демпфирования.

Примеры

свернуть все

Найдите назначение модели демпфирования для модели 3-D.

Создайте переходную несущую модель.

structuralModel = createpde('structural','transient-solid');

Импортируйте и постройте график геометрии.

importGeometry(structuralModel,'Block.stl');
pdegplot(structuralModel,'CellLabels','on')

Figure contains an axes. The axes contains 3 objects of type quiver, patch, line.

Задайте параметр пропорционального демпфирования жесткости.

structuralDamping(structuralModel,'Beta',40);

Теперь задайте массовый пропорциональный параметр демпфирования.

structuralDamping(structuralModel,'Alpha',10);

Проверьте назначение параметров демпфирования на structuralModel. Заметьте, что B etaпараметр пуст.

findStructuralDamping(structuralModel.DampingModels)
ans = 
  StructuralDampingAssignment with properties:

      RegionType: 'Cell'
        RegionID: 1
    DampingModel: "proportional"
           Alpha: 10
            Beta: []
            Zeta: []

Когда вы задаете параметры демпфирования путем вызова structuralDamping функция несколько раз, тулбокс использует последнее назначение. Задайте и массу, и параметры жесткости.

structuralDamping(structuralModel,'Alpha',10,'Beta',40);

Проверьте назначение параметров демпфирования на structuralModel.

findStructuralDamping(structuralModel.DampingModels)
ans = 
  StructuralDampingAssignment with properties:

      RegionType: 'Cell'
        RegionID: 1
    DampingModel: "proportional"
           Alpha: 10
            Beta: 40
            Zeta: []

Входные параметры

свернуть все

Демпфирующая модель несущей модели, заданная как DampingModels свойство StructuralModel объект.

Выходные аргументы

свернуть все

Назначение модели демпфирования, возвращаемое как StructuralDampingAssignment объект. Для получения дополнительной информации смотрите Свойства StructuralDampingAssignment.

Введенный в R2018a